We are looking for primary care and pediatrics providers to deliver orphan care to this extremely impoverished area of Zambia. The stark reality of Zambia is the overabundance of orphaned children that have been left, forgotten, or ignored. Zambia has the highest per capita orphan rate in the world with approximately 1.4 million orphans in a country roughly the size of Texas.  This country was ravaged by HIV/AIDS. Our national partners tell us there is little HIV there now as they have largely died off. When a child is orphaned they usually becomes the responsibility of a distant family member or neighbor but because they are another mouth to feed, these children are usually not welcomed and considered a burden. Many are forced to find their own food and sleep outside. One in every four households is a child-headed home with a child acting as the primary caregiver.

On this trip, we will be serving primarily orphans along with local people in each area. In this area, most exist on less than one dollar per day.  We are working with a small local church and school living and serving in this area. They have little to no access to health care although many have received vaccinations. They have essentially no dental care. Since we will be seeing a large number of children we really need an optometrist who can size glasses.
